Student Hunger Advocate Spring 2025

 Danielle and I work together as Nutrition & Recipe development students to write nutritious food plans for the RCSJ Food Drive. Twice a month, RCSJ has fresh food days where they use a budget to go grocery shopping for lower income students. This year they decided they would like to prep meal kits and that is where we help out.
